Bamuni Pahar

Bamuni Pahar , located about 3 km from Tezpur town on the banks of the Brahmaputra River, is an archaeologically significant site. The area is scattered with numerous stone remnants that, according to experts, date back to the 8th and 9th centuries. Archaeologist R.D. Banerjee suggested that the site once housed seven temples. Haleswar Temple

Haleswar Temple, located near Tezpur, is an ancient temple of great historical and spiritual significance. It is believed to have originated during the time when the capital of Kamrupa was established at Harupeswar. Mahabhairabh Temple

Mahabhairabh Temple is a prominent landmark that enhances the charm of the beautiful town of Tezpur. The temple houses a massive Shiva Linga, believed to be one of the largest in the world, crafted from living stone by the demon king Banasura, according to legend. Agnigarh

This hillock on bank of river Brahmaputra is the site of legendary romance of princess Usha (the only daughter of king Bana) and Anirudha, grand son of lord Krishna.
